Window Leak Water Removal Cost in Artondale, WA
The cost of window leak water removal in Artondale,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s for this service. Prices may vary!
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and amount of water present |
| Drying and d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and level of soiling |
| Final inspection and restoration |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and type of repairs needed |
| Specialized equipment rental | $100 – $500 | Type of equipment needed and rental duration |
| Travel fees (if applicable) | $25 – $100 | Distance from our location to your property |

How do I prevent window leaks in the future?
Regular maintenance, such as checking and tightening window seals, can help prevent window leaks. Also, installing weatherstripping or replacing old windows can also help prevent future issues. Prevention is key!
